Understanding the Pecan Creek Real Estate Market
Before diving into the sales process, understanding the unique characteristics of the Pecan Creek real estate market is essential. This affluent community enjoys a strong demand for its charming, well-maintained homes, often attracting buyers seeking a quiet, suburban lifestyle.
Market Trends
-
Consistent Demand: Pecan Creek has experienced steady demand over the past decade, with minimal fluctuations in home values. This stability indicates a healthy market and favorable conditions for sellers.
-
High Buyer Interest: The area’s proximity to Phoenix and its excellent school districts make it an attractive choice for families and young professionals, ensuring a consistent stream of interested buyers.
Property Values and Pricing
-
Home Value Range: Properties in Pecan Creek typically range from $300,000 to $800,000, with some custom-built homes exceeding this on the high end. The average home value has appreciated by approximately 5% annually over the past five years.
-
Pricing Strategies: To successfully sell your home, pricing is crucial. Consider factors like square footage, lot size, recent comparable sales, and any unique features to determine a competitive listing price. Timing is also essential; spring and early summer often see higher buyer activity.
Preparing Your Pecan Creek Home for Sale
A well-prepared property can significantly enhance the selling experience. The following steps will help you stage your home effectively and attract potential buyers:
1. Declutter and Deep Clean
- Start by decluttering your space, removing personal items that might deter buyers. Consider renting a storage unit to temporarily house excess belongings.
- Conduct a thorough cleaning, focusing on high-traffic areas and rooms that buyers will inspect. A sparkling home creates a positive first impression.
2. Stage Your Home for Maximum Appeal
- Set the Right Mood: Use neutral colors on walls and consider re-staining or refinishing wood surfaces to create a modern aesthetic.
- Enhance Curb Appeal: Ensure the exterior is inviting by trimming hedges, mowing the lawn, and adding vibrant flower beds or potted plants.
- Showcase Living Spaces: Arrange furniture to maximize natural light and create open, welcoming spaces. Use decorative accents sparingly to avoid clutter.
- Highlight Unique Features: Emphasize any distinctive architectural elements, built-in shelves, or custom lighting fixtures.
3. Conduct Repairs and Upgrades (If Necessary)
- Address minor repairs like loose doorknobs, leaky faucets, or cracked windows promptly. These issues can be red flags for buyers.
- Consider strategic upgrades to increase your home’s value. Updates in high-demand areas like kitchens and bathrooms will have the most impact.
4. Create a Stunning Outdoor Space
- Pecan Creek homes often boast lovely outdoor living areas. Stage your patio or backyard to create a relaxing retreat, complete with comfortable seating and attractive landscaping.
- Add lighting to extend the livable space outdoors, especially if your home has a sparkling pool or hot tub.
Marketing Your Property Effectively
Once your home is ready for sale, it’s time to put marketing strategies in motion to reach potential buyers. Here’s how to make your Pecan Creek property stand out:
Professional Photography and Virtual Tours
- Invest in high-quality photography that showcases the best features of your home, both indoors and outdoors. Professional images are crucial for capturing buyers’ attention.
- Consider a 3D virtual tour to provide an immersive online experience. This technology allows remote buyers to virtually walk through your home, increasing the likelihood of an in-person visit.
Compelling Listing Description
- Write a detailed yet engaging description that highlights the unique qualities of your property. Include information about recent upgrades, nearby amenities, and any special features like a smart home system or energy-efficient appliances.
- Use keywords naturally to optimize your listing for online searches, but avoid over-optimization. The keyword "Pecan Creek" should appear contextually 3-5 times throughout the description.
Social Media and Online Listings
- Post high-quality photos and a comprehensive description on popular real estate websites like Zillow, Redfin, and Realtor.com. These platforms are often the first stop for potential buyers.
- Utilize social media channels like Instagram and Facebook to reach a wider audience. Create engaging posts with eye-catching visuals and informative captions.

Negotiation and Sale Finalization
The selling process reaches its climax with negotiations and the final sale.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you navigate this crucial phase:
Negotiating with Buyers
- Listen and Respond: Carefully consider buyer offers and respond promptly. Be open to negotiation but also know your bottom line.
- Counter Strategically: If an offer falls short of your expectations, counter with a reasonable request. Explain the rationale behind your counteroffer to buyers.
- Consider All Offers: Evaluate each offer based on price, terms, and buyer qualifications. Don’t automatically accept the highest bid if it doesn’t align with your priorities.
Accepting an Offer and Moving Forward
- Review and Accept: Once you’ve decided on an offer, review the purchase agreement carefully. Ensure all terms are acceptable and sign the documents.
- Set a Closing Date: Collaborate with your real estate agent and the buyer’s agent to schedule a closing date, typically 30-60 days after accepting the offer.
- Prepare for Inspection: Buyers will often conduct a home inspection. Address any issues raised in the report to ensure a smooth closing.
